Slate roof leak repair services involve identifying and addressing leaks that occur in slate roofing systems. These services typically include inspecting the roof to locate the source of the leak, which may be caused by cracked, broken, or missing slate tiles, as well as damaged or deteriorated flashing and sealants. Repair specialists may replace damaged slate tiles, reseal joints, and reinforce vulnerable areas to prevent future leaks.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ity while maintaining its original appearance, ensuring that the property remains protected from water intrusion.
Leaks in slate roofs can lead to significant problems if left unaddressed. Water infiltration can cause damage to underlying roof structures, insulation, and interior finishes, potentially resulting in mold growth, wood rot, and structural deterioration. Additionally, persistent leaks may compromise the overall stability of the roof, increasing the risk of more extensive and costly repairs. By promptly repairing leaks, property owners can prevent further damage, preserve the value of the building, and maintain a safe and dry interior environment.

Average Costs - The typical cost for slate roof leak repairs ranges from $1,000 to $4,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air complexity. Smaller repairs near the roof surface tend to be on the lower end, while extensive fixes can be more costly.
Material and Labor Expenses - Repair costs often include both labor and materials, with labor fees averaging $50 to $100 per hour. Material costs for slate tiles or patches can add $200 to $1,500, based on the repair scope.
Factors Influencing Price - The size of the leak and accessibility of the roof influence repair costs, with larger or hard-to-reach areas typically requiring higher expenses. Additional work such as replacing damaged slate or waterproofing can increase overall costs.

What are common signs of a slate roof leak?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or cracked slate tiles, and the presence of mold or mildew near the roof area.
How do professionals typically repair slate roof leaks? Repair methods often involve replacing damaged or missing slate tiles, sealing cracks, and ensuring proper flashing around roof penetrations.
Is it necessary to replace the entire slate roof if a leak occurs? Not necessarily; many leaks can be fixed by repairing or replacing specific damaged sections without a full roof replacement.
How long do slate roof repairs usually take? Repair durations vary depending on the extent of damage, but many repairs can be completed within a few days by local service providers.
